Job Description



MSX International is seeking dynamic individuals to join our team. As a Mobile Service Solutions Specialist, you’ll play a crucial role in the professional delivery, installation, and sustainment of the Ford/MSX International Mobile Service Program. Our goal is to improve dealership performance and drive sustained growth. 

What Your Day-to- Day Responsibilities Include:

As the Mobile Service Solutions Specialist, you will: 

  • Be the subject matter expert and primary contact for all things related to Mobile Service for your assigned dealers. 
  • Understand how Mobile Service vehicle’s function and train technicians on their features. 
  • Facilitate strategic planning sessions with dealers to create business plans for success. 
  • Ensure dealers are ready to launch vans promptly upon arrival. 
  • Conduct launch events, aligning on business goals and training Mobile Service Technicians. 
  • Plan and execute tailored onsite sustainment meetings focused on Mobile Service business development with a consultative approach.
  • Develop action plans to exceed program goals, focusing on service processes. 
  • Teach program standards and key success drivers with dealers. 
  • Monitor and motivate dealership Mobile Service personnel to provide excellent customer experiences. 
  • Create visit summaries and action plans for stakeholders.
